The opioid crisis continues to challenge healthcare providers and researchers, pushing the need for effective treatment options beyond traditional medication-assisted therapies (MATs) like methadone and buprenorphine. One emerging alternative that has gained significant attention is kratom, a botanical supplement derived from the leaves of Mitragyna speciosa, a tree indigenous to Southeast Asia. Kratom has been widely discussed for its potential in alleviating opioid withdrawal symptoms, reducing cravings, and managing chronic pain.

Understanding Kratom: Mechanisms and Effects
Kratom contains mitragynine and 7-hydroxymitragynine, two alkaloids that interact with opioid receptors in the brain, producing both stimulant and opioid-like effects depending on the dose. At low doses, kratom acts as a mild stimulant, increasing energy and focus. At higher doses, it exhibits sedative and analgesic properties, mimicking the effects of opioids.
These pharmacological properties have led many to explore kratom as an alternative to conventional opioids, especially in managing chronic pain and opioid withdrawal symptoms. However, kratom’s complex pharmacology also raises concerns about dependence, potential toxicity, and lack of regulatory oversight.
Kratom as a Harm Reduction Tool: What Research Says
1. Kratom’s Role in Opioid Withdrawal and Recovery
Several surveys and studies suggest that kratom may help individuals transition away from prescription opioids and illicit drugs. In a 2020 study conducted by Kirsten Smith and her colleagues at Johns Hopkins University, participants who used kratom for opioid withdrawal reported high rates of symptom relief:
- 87% found kratom effective in alleviating withdrawal symptoms
- 80% reported reduced opioid cravings
- 86% experienced pain relief
These findings align with anecdotal evidence from individuals who claim that kratom provided a viable alternative when conventional treatments like methadone and buprenorphine were inaccessible or ineffective.
2. Addiction Potential and Dependence Risks
While kratom appears to offer harm reduction benefits, it is not without risks. Research indicates that long-term kratom use can lead to dependence, with withdrawal symptoms resembling those of traditional opioids. A study published in Frontiers in Pharmacology in 2021 documented cases of kratom dependence, withdrawal, and escalating tolerance, with some individuals reporting symptoms such as:
- Increased dosage requirements over time
- Insomnia, agitation, and anxiety upon discontinuation
- Gastrointestinal discomfort and loss of appetite
Despite these concerns, many harm reduction advocates argue that kratom dependence is far less severe than opioid addiction, and when used responsibly, it poses a lower risk of overdose compared to heroin, fentanyl, and prescription opioids.
3. Potential Health Risks and Adverse Effects
In high doses, kratom can lead to severe health complications, particularly when taken in extract form or combined with other substances. Clinical reports have documented cases of:
- Liver toxicity in individuals consuming high-dose kratom extracts
- Seizures and cardiac events in users with high tolerance
- Respiratory depression, though at significantly lower rates than opioids
A notable case involved Krypton, a contaminated kratom product that caused nine fatalities in Sweden due to adulteration with O-desmethyltramadol, a potent opioid. This highlights the urgent need for better regulation and quality control in the kratom industry.
The Regulatory Landscape: How Kratom is Managed in the U.S. and Abroad
Kratom’s legal status remains highly debated, with significant differences in regulatory approaches between countries and even within U.S. states.
U.S. Regulation: A Complex Challenge
In the United States, kratom is regulated as a dietary supplement under the Dietary Supplement Health and Education Act (DSHEA) of 1994. This classification allows kratom to be sold without pre-market approval from the FDA, meaning there are limited safety evaluations before products reach consumers.
The FDA and DEA have expressed concerns about kratom’s safety, with the DEA attempting to classify it as a Schedule I controlled substance in 2016. However, public backlash and advocacy efforts led to a withdrawal of the ban, leaving regulation to individual states.
Several states have implemented their own kratom policies:
- Banned: Alabama, Arkansas, Indiana, Rhode Island, Vermont, Wisconsin
- Regulated: Arizona, Georgia, Nevada, Utah (requiring quality standards and age restrictions)
- Unregulated: Most other states, where kratom remains legally available
Global Regulation: Stricter Oversight in Other Regions
In contrast to the relaxed regulatory approach in the U.S., many other nations have imposed strict controls on kratom:
- Banned: Australia, Sweden, Denmark, Finland, Japan, and Malaysia
- Heavily restricted: Thailand (where it was illegal for decades before limited medical use was permitted)
- Tightly regulated but available: European Union, China (subject to food safety and supplement laws)
The European Union, through the European Food Safety Authority (EFSA), requires kratom manufacturers to adhere to stringent safety and labeling requirements, ensuring greater transparency for consumers.
The Future of Kratom in Addiction Treatment and Harm Reduction
The scientific community remains divided on whether kratom should be widely adopted in addiction recovery programs. Advocates argue that, much like methadone and buprenorphine, kratom serves as a harm reduction tool, reducing opioid-related mortality. Critics highlight the risks of dependence and lack of standardization, which could lead to inconsistent efficacy and safety profiles.
Key Questions for Future Research:
- Can kratom be standardized to ensure safer consumption?
- What are the long-term health effects of kratom use?
- How does kratom compare to FDA-approved opioid addiction treatments in clinical trials?
- Could medical supervision improve kratom’s safety profile and effectiveness?
Conclusion: A Balanced Perspective on Kratom’s Role in Addiction Recovery
Kratom presents a complex but promising alternative for individuals struggling with opioid dependence. While emerging research supports its use as a harm reduction tool, significant gaps in safety data, regulation, and medical supervision must be addressed.
